摘要: 1、项目初始化操作 # 1、初始化数据 python manager.py db init python manager.py db migrate 设计表,默认一定是自增模式,和django不同,需要去数据库自己设计 # 插入数据 curl -X POST -i -H "Content-Type: 阅读全文
posted @ 2020-04-06 23:23 王竹笙 阅读(335) 评论(0) 推荐(0) 编辑
摘要: 首先安装模块: pip install flask-restful ##官方文档的例子: from flask import Flask from flask_restful import Resource,Api app = Flask(__name__) api = Api(app) class 阅读全文
posted @ 2020-04-06 21:06 王竹笙 阅读(459) 评论(0) 推荐(0) 编辑
摘要: 什么是 REST? 六条设计规范定义了一个 REST 系统的特点: 客户端-服务器: 客户端和服务器之间隔离,服务器提供服务,客户端进行消费。 无状态: 从客户端到服务器的每个请求都必须包含理解请求所必需的信息。换句话说, 服务器不会存储客户端上一次请求的信息用来给下一次使用。 可缓存: 服务器必须 阅读全文
posted @ 2020-04-06 15:57 王竹笙 阅读(324) 评论(0) 推荐(0) 编辑
摘要: 网上例子 https://github.com/miguelgrinberg/REST-auth Restful API不保存状态,无法依赖Cookie及Session来保存用户信息,自然也无法使用Flask-Login扩展来实现用户认证。所以这里,我们就要介绍另一个扩展,Flask-HTTPAut 阅读全文
posted @ 2020-04-06 14:26 王竹笙 阅读(560) 评论(0) 推荐(0) 编辑
摘要: SQLAlchemy https://dormousehole.readthedocs.io/en/latest/patterns/sqlalchemy.html?highlight=sql pip install Flask-SQLAlchemy pip install SQLAlchemy [r 阅读全文
posted @ 2020-04-06 14:25 王竹笙 阅读(315) 评论(0) 推荐(0) 编辑